HOW TO BUILD A STRATEGIC BUDGET FOR 2022
Building budgets change year by year depending on the stage of the company, industry market performances, state of the economy, and uncontrolled variables like Covid-19. In this Startup Study Hall, expert CFO, Kathy Kinder will explain how you begin to think and plan more strategically about your company’s income (if you’re lucky enough to be making some yet!) and expenses. This will be an idyllic opportunity to refine your 2022 budget, or if you haven’t planned one yet, you can work on it during this time. Kathy will address the following topics:
- What expenses do you have at: day 1, a year out, a few years into it etc.
- Expenses to account for when transitioning from W-9s to W-2s
- How to pull info from Quickbooks to plan for income by month
Attendees will learn what they need to have in their budgets for 2022 so they can benchmark their successes and pivot when challenges arise.

BIO OF KATHY KINDER
Kathy Kinder is the Founder and Managing Director of LiftBridge CXO. The women-led team supports early stage and growth technology companies by offering: interim, part-time, and project-based chief financial officer (CFO) services. LiftBridge CXO can provide valuable knowledge and services to bridge the gap between where you are now and where you want to go.
As former CFO at Healthx, $25M revenue (3 years) and Consona Corporation $130M revenue (9 years), Kathy is experienced with financial planning, mergers and acquisitions, accounting, financing and more. Kathy is the founder of Lift Bridge CXO and is currently capitalizing on the experience and knowledge gained from over 25 years working in startups, growth, and mature tech companies by providing consulting services to startup and scaling businesses. Some of Kathy’s current clients include WorkHere, Beyond Payroll, AwayZones and others. Kathy is an Indiana University graduate. Ask her about dogs.
